logo

Output abdec966bb60e2763dd3ffa343f7814fad538edfdd229a5926f533fcffd8b9fd:17

value
2559900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 238055266254763d6c60777be2d37e369517dc3e OP_EQUAL
address
34vjJxtNgecdvt1tpcrHHDkEY4MBGnSHaK
transaction
abdec966bb60e2763dd3ffa343f7814fad538edfdd229a5926f533fcffd8b9fd